US watchdog fines KPMG Australia over ‘widespread’ cheating on online training tests – The Guardian Australia
More than 1,100 staff including 250 auditors involved in ‘improper answer sharing’, the Public Company Accounting Oversight Board…

BusinessMore than 1,100 staff including 250 auditors involved in improper answer sharing, the Public Company Accounting Oversight Board finds
Wed 15 Sep 2021 03.18 EDT
KPMG Australia has been fined US$450,000 (A$615,000) by the US audit watchdog over widespread…
